Farmers finance papers. Townley ties up control in Northwest Bureau

Hundreds of farmers invest in weekly newspapers via corporations governed by the Northwest Service Bureau, an arm of the National Nonpartisan League led by A Townley. Shares grant voting power to preferred stock, letting the Bureau consolidate influence across North Dakota Minnesota Montana and South Dakota as promoters take 35 percent while farmers risk liability. The arrangement, approved by the state board of regents, centralizes control without direct capital from the farmers.

Minnesota GOP Nomination Fight Narrows Lead for Burnquist

Governor Burnquist leads Lindbergh by nearly 60,000 votes in the Minnesota Republican primary as 3,909 precincts report. Knute Nelson dominates the U S Senate race with 213,207 votes to James A. Louie’s 81,768. Local results also show Andrew Volstead and Fred Wheaton in a contested House nomination race. Bank Board to meet to discuss deposits guarantee operations starting July 1.

Stockyards in United States Ordered to Collateral License

Washington June 20. All stock yards in the United States were ordered by President Wilson to obtain collateral licenses. Licenses must be obtained from the food administration on or before July 25. Licensing also applies to commission men order buyers traders speculators and scalpers handling live cattle sheep swine or tin in any way connected with such trades unless exempted by the food and fuel law.

Americans Over Top For A Gain In Chateau Thierry Sector

United States forces attacked the German lines northwest of Chateau Thierry during the night and advanced five eighths of a mile, seizing positions on the Belleau Wood northern pocket without resistance as Germans withdrew. Allied reports also note successful bombing of Conflane railroad yards and ongoing artillery activity along the front. British raiding actions near Boyelles Arras Lens Givenchy Strazeele and Ypres sites produced clashes with enemy casualties and several prisoners.

Demonstrations For Peace In German Cities

A Stockholm dispatch to The Morning Post reports peace demonstrations recently held in Berlin Hamburg and Cologne. Police and military dispersed crowds while several workers were killed and many persons arrested amid the unrest.

Riots Erupt Across Austria Over Bread Ration Cut

News from Amsterdam and London reports Vienna rioting after Austria Hungary cuts bread rations. Mob loots bakeries and attacks government sites while cavalry moves in. martial law possible. Separate dispatch notes Kiev revolt spreading with artillery stores blown and mass armed participation. Moscow reports Ukrainian delegates press Black Sea fleet involvement. Soviet leadership rejects demand.
